PARES is a consulting firm which focus on strategic planning and participatory methodologies in order to optimize results in all three dimensions of sustainability: economic, social and environmental ones. This is achieved through stakeholders' engagement in the organizational strategy, contemplating intersectoral alliances and networks and, therefore, enhancing innovation.
PARES is a Latin word, that in Portuguese is also one of the possible translations for stakeholders. PARES letters, in English as well as in Portuguese, stand for Planning, Articulation, Responsiveness, Entrepreneurship and Sustainability, key elements of the cycle of sustainable development.

Why Sustainable Results?
As defined in 1987 by the World Commission on Environment and Development, which became known as the Brundtland Commission, sustainable development "meets current needs without compromising the ability of future generations to meet theirs." In practical terms, this means striving not only for economic but also for social and environmental results in the long term. Those can be achieved in an integrated manner when inserted into the construction of the vision of future for an organization and, afterwards, into goal setting and alignment. Through dialogue and engagement of internal and external stakeholders, we seek for sustainable solutions for the critical points of each organization.

PARES Institute
PARES maintains “Instituto PARES” (PARES Institute), a nonprofit organization that aims at generating and sharing knowledge and intersectoral solutions for the sustainable development, building solutions with organizations of the three sectors. It was founded in 2010, in Rio de Janeiro, by professionals with prior experience in the second and third sectors, who identified the need for a space for exchanging experiences and learning.
Vision: Being a central pole and the reference to sustainable development among sectors.
PARES Institute is at “Solar das Palmeiras”, a beautiful house over 200 years old, preserved by IPHAN, located in Botafogo, Rio de Janeiro, as result of a partnership with a philantropic institution, "Obras Sociais Santa Margarida Maria".
